At Pompeii, a private guide with your group leads the visit, offering a focused and informative tour of the archaeological park. The entrance fee to Pompeii is included in the price, and the guide ensures you see key highlights within 2 hours. The visit provides insights into the Roman city’s layout, architecture, and history, making it a valuable experience for history buffs or those curious about ancient civilizations.
The itinerary includes a lunch break before the Pompeii visit, giving you time to enjoy a pizza and drink. The one-hour stop in Pompeii is designed to prepare you for the guided tour with some local flavors to start the day.
After Pompeii, the tour drops you in Sorrento’s main square, dedicated to the poet Torquato Tasso. Here, the pedestrian-only area makes exploring easy and pleasant. You’ll be shown around the heart of Sorrento, giving you free time to take in the local shops, cafes, and scenic views at your own pace.
The two-hour visit in Sorrento offers a relaxed atmosphere where you can appreciate the town’s atmosphere, snap photos, or enjoy a gelato from a third-generation gelateria. The walk is manageable for most, and the area’s charm makes for a memorable stop.
